Output 6b29ba699424ce7c77aa1a9193b6ce1d5765435e902b59cac27eb4cbe019688f:22

value
465792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26b3a5836131fb3c2483537a0e13074e8e61092 OP_EQUAL
address
3LscH9sm9nPq9q223zTs2tLeZRFUNdHAeN
transaction
6b29ba699424ce7c77aa1a9193b6ce1d5765435e902b59cac27eb4cbe019688f
spent
true